Re: IP Profile/ speed boost Helppp :D

Quote
but doesnt a low ip profile mean the speed cant raise?

Hi there,
Just to clarify the IP profile wasn't low so it wasn't an issue, the only time we can make an adjustment to fix a profile issue directly would be for example if the profile on our systems did not match BT's IP profile, in that instance we could adjust our profile to bring them in line with each other again.
Just to mention we're unable to raise faults via here, simply as we'd not be party to all the information requested, in the event of the checker not working correctly for you we'd advise you to call in.
Quote
Will that keep raising til i get to 5.5mb-6mb like before?

Hopefully it will following a line reset I've just performed. From running a line test I can see a reduction in the IP profile and the fault threshold rate as it looks like they were recalculated when the line was still seeing some disconnections.
Let me know if you don't see any change after 24 hours.
